Overview

Viluchinsk Zerkalka is a kitesurfing spot near the closed city of Viluchinsk, on the east coast of the Kamchatka Peninsula, in Avacha Bay. The name "Zerkalka" refers to the nearby calm lake or water body.

Avacha Bay offers a semi-sheltered water body with a spectacular setting: snow-capped volcanoes in the background, including Vilyuchinsky (2173 m). Conditions are calmer than open sea but remain demanding.

Winds come mainly from the south and southeast in summer. Season is very short, July to September. Water is very cold (5-13°C), drysuit or semi-dry mandatory. Spot reserved for experienced riders due to remoteness and extreme conditions.
